logo
Автоматизация методик исследования профессиональной направленности старшеклассников

2.1 Обзор программных средств для разработки тестов

На сегодняшний день, на рынке средств разработки программного обеспечения, существует огромное количество разнообразнейших программ от мощных программных комплексов до простых компиляторов и интерпретаторов. Такие средства разработки, как Borland C++ (да и вообще средства построенные на основе языка программирования C++) гибки в настройках и позволяют строить сложные программные комплексы, но требуют достаточно высокого уровня программирования от разработчика. Такой мощный пакет, как Microsoft Visual Studio (построенный на том же языке C++), позволяющий строить интерфейс приложения визуально, требует не одной недели освоения даже опытным программистом.

Второй по популярности язык программирования - Паскаль (Pascal). Он обладает более простым для понимания синтаксисов и набором команд, позволяющим более просто реализовывать некоторые функции. На основе компилятора этого языка (а точнее Object Pascal, являющегося объектно-ориентированной версией Pascalя) построено такое RAD-средство (средство быстрой разработки приложений), как Borland Delphi, в котором совмещены два таких немаловажных аспекта, как визуальное программирование и наличие простых и доступных средств работы с базами данных /6,8,25,26,27/.

Для разработки автоматизированного теста была выбрана среда программирования Borland Delphi. Среди всех существующих версий, мы выбрали среду разработки Delphi 5, поскольку она позволяет просто строить интерфейс разрабатываемого приложения и легко работать с базами данных.